1990 Porsche 911 964 C2
Hey everyone, the time has come to find her a new home
127,XXX miles on chassis
Approx. 10k on engine rebuild
Car has been repainted at one point during my possession.
20-50 Brad Penn always used since engine rebuild. Oil changed religiously.
Always garaged
Exterior:
Refreshed Paint
RS style rear wing with carbon fiber
Common windshield rust issue addressed
GT front lip
Rear tow hook (Rennline)
Front tow hook (Rennline)
Genuine Porsche 17in 10 spoke wheels painted gold
Brake ducts (not functional, but can be made functional)
Interior:
Momo wheel
Steering wheel spacer
Corbeau suede seats
Half cage
Crow 4 point harnesses
Engine:
Full top end rebuild
valve guides
chain
plugs
piston rings
new fuel filter
etc
(Too much to list. Rebuilt by Porsche Specialists “S Car Go” in San Rafael. Invoice available upon request)
Reground Cams (Elgin)
Rs flywheel and clutch
Secondary muffler bypass
Test pipe (cat delete)
911Chips ECU (chip)
Secondary oil cooler
(fresh oil change)
Other upgrades:
Zimmerman rotors
Steel brake lines
Cool Carbon pads
ATE Blue fluid (in clutch as well)
Removed brake bias
C4 (2 pod) rear calipers
Rennline 3 point strut brace
Custom rear wheel spacers
HR Green springs paired with Koni adjustable shocks
Currently corner balanced for 180b driver
Stock parts that come with the car:
Seats
Steering wheel
A/C parts
Brake bias valve
Stock cat
Rear seats
Original deck lid with functional spoiler
Stock seat belts
Other miscellaneous parts
